About the Team
This is a newly formed team spearheaded in London. The role has a global reach providing leadership and oversight across multiple time zones including the US and Yerevan. The teams primary mandate is to transform the employee technology experience shifting from traditional IT support to a modern automated and security-first engineering discipline. The Lead will establish the foundation recruit top talent and drive a culture of continuous improvement through AI deep automation and integration.
About the Role
This is a critical leadership position to spearhead the creation and development of a new End User Engineering (EUE) team in London. The primary mandate is to transform the employee technology experience from traditional IT support to a modern automated and security-first engineering discipline.
What youll do
- Establish and Lead the Global End User Engineering (EUE) Team: Define the organizational structure actively recruit and mentor the founding team and establish a high-performance engineering-led culture. Successfully manage the technical team across multiple time zones (US and Yerevan)
- Drive Deep Automation and AI Integration: Champion the strategy for intelligent automation to eliminate toil and reduce MTTR. Proactively explore and implement AI/ML solutions for intelligent service routing and predictive issue detection
- Engineer and Integrate Enterprise Workflows: Design build and maintain robust scalable integrations between core enterprise applications (identity HRIS collaboration service tools) to create seamless automated employee experiences
- Own Core SaaS Application Enhancement: Take engineering ownership of and strategically enhance critical enterprise SaaS applications including Slack G-Suite Jira JAMF and Glean ensuring high reliability
- Execute the Strategic Technical Roadmap: Develop and execute the long-term vision and technical roadmap for EUE integrating agile engineering methodologies like CI/CD and Infrastructure as Code principles
- Ensure Security and Compliance Posture: Work in close collaboration with Corporate Security (CorpSec) to define and enforce robust system security standards across all managed applications and devices. Partner with the Privacy team on compliance and execute regular security and compliance audits
What youll need
- 5-7 years of progressive experience in IT Operations Infrastructure or End User Services with a minimum of 2 years in a Team Lead or Managerial capacity building technical teams
- Proven experience successfully leading and managing geographically or time-zone distributed technical teams (e.g. US Europe Yerevan)
- Strong hands-on engineering experience with the core technology stack including Slack G-Suite Jira JAMF and similar collaboration/device management applications
- Demonstrable experience successfully delivering and maintaining automation platforms workflows and integrations using technologies like Python JavaScript or dedicated iPaaS solutions
- Strong working knowledge of IT security principles access control models and experience collaborating with security teams on compliance and audit remediation
- Acumen for building an engineering-led culture focused on scalability continuous improvement and integrating agile methodologies (like CI/CD/IaC)
